Team, ahead of the eng sync: this week's RateMirror release tightens how the parity checker reconciles channel rates for the Pellwick property group. We now normalize tax-inclusive and tax-exclusive quotes before comparison, which eliminated the spurious mismatch alerts reported last sprint. Canary ran for 48 hours across both regions with zero regressions, and alert volume dropped roughly 40%. Full rollout is scheduled for Thursday morning. The candidate is identified by the build token below.

trace token, tawep-fahif: htk3_b58

Welcome to on-call for the Glimmerpane design system! Our snapshot tests live in the `snapcheck` suite and run on every merge to main. If a UI component changes visually, the diff bot flags it — usually it's an intentional tweak, so just approve the new baseline. If it's 2am and snapshots are failing across the board, it's almost always a font-loading race, not your problem. To unlock the baseline store and re-approve snapshots in bulk, use the recovery passphrase below.

recovery phrase for tahag-taguf: wenix-caswyn

Meeting notes — FeedCheck sync: We agreed the podcast feed validator should flag missing enclosure tags as warnings, not hard errors, since half of Castwell's test feeds fail otherwise. Review the regex change in the RSS parser carefully before merge. Any questions on the validation rules should go to the person below.

named custodian: Brivan Eliath Quenox Frador